Walk of The Lonesome
i found a boy sitting on a curb
as i walked by I smiled as politely as i could
my mind raced trying to think what I would say
if he smiled back
how i wished he would
i saw a girl yesterday
watched as she attempted a smile
my mind raced- tried to think what to say
and the words were on my lips
hopes to ease her pain
but the moment passed and I, and she, walked away.
